Gloc-9 has come out to declare his support for the candidacy of VP Leni Robredo in her quest to become the next president of the Philippines.

Source: Instagram
In VP Leni’s recently released political ad, the famous rapper was among the celebrities who declared their support for VP Leni.
“Handa na ang Pilipinas para sa kulay rosas na bukas,” Gloc-9 said in the video.

All of those who appeared in the video, including the famous rapper, were then shown in small thumbnails declaring the battle cry of the governmental goal of VP Leni.
“Ang gobyernong tapat para sa lahat,” celebrities and ordinary folks said in unison.
Some netizens were surprised by the appearance of Gloc-9 in the new political ad.
Perhaps their surprise stemmed from the fact that the famous rapper had not given any indication in the past as to who he would be supporting for president in this year’s elections.
Gloc-9 is known for churning out hit songs that usually touch on relevant social issues.
Si Aristotle Pollisco o mas kilala bilang si Gloc-9 ay itinuturing na isa sa mga “Best Filipino rappers of all-time.” Nagsimula ang kanyang career noong 1990 ngunit mas nakilala siya noong taong 2003 nang mag-release siya ng solo album. Si Gloc-9 ang nagpasikat ng mga kantang “Sirena” kung saan nakasama niya ang isa ring OPM artist na si Ebe Dancel, “Hari Ng Tondo,” at “Simpleng Tao.”
Last year, Gloc-9 shared his graduation photo taken 11 years before. He said he graduated from a nursing course but he still chose to rap. Nevertheless, he admitted he won't be rapping forever and if given the chance to work in the field of nursing, he would be very grateful.
In March of this year, he also shared a pic where he is with celebrity siblings, Maxene and Elmo Magalona. According to the famous rapper, he was happy to see the children of his late friend and idol, Francis Magalona. He was also amazed that he got to see them again on Kiko's 13th death anniversary.
